Usage

The infobox may be added by pasting the template as shown below into an article and then filling in the desired fields. Any parameters left blank or omitted will not be displayed.

Blank template with basic parameters

{{Infobox person
| name        = <!-- include middle initial -->
| image       = <!-- just the filename, without the File: or Image: prefix or enclosing [[brackets]] -->
| alt         = 
| caption     = 
| bio1        = 
| nationality = 
| known_for   = 
| occupation  = 
}}

Parameters

Do not use all these parameters for any one person. The list is long to cover a wide range of people. Only use those parameters that convey essential or notable information about the subject. Any parameters left blank or omitted will not be displayed. If a data field has more than one parameter name which can be used, the preferred name is listed first in bold print.

Parameter Explanation
honorific_prefix To appear on the line above the person's name
name Common name of person (defaults to article name if left blank; provide birth_name (below) if different from name). If middle initials are specified (or implied) by the lede of the article, and are not specified seperately in the birth_name field, include them here.
honorific_suffix To appear on the line below the person's name
native_name The person's name in their own language, if different.
native_name_lang Wikipedia:ISO 639-2 code e.g. "fre" or "fra" for French.
image Image name: abc.jpg, xpz.png, 123.gif, etc. If an image is desired but not available, one may add "yes" to the "needs-photo" section of the Wikipedia:Template:WPBiography on the talkpage. If no image is available yet, do not use an image placeholder.
image_size
(imagesize)
Size to display image: 200px (set width), x300px (set height), or 200x300px (max width & max height). This defaults to frameless (default is 220px, but logged in users can change this by clicking on "my preferences" and adjusting thumbnail size) if empty or omitted. This parameter should not normally need to be set.
alt Alt text for image, for visually impaired readers. One word (such as "photograph") is rarely sufficient. See Wikipedia:WP:ALT.
caption Caption for image, if needed. Try to include date of photo and the photographer.
birth_name Name at birth; only use if different from name.
bio1, bio2, bio3, bio4 4 paragraphs that can be used for the biography.
residence Location(s) where the person notably resides/resided, if different from birth place. Do not use a flag template.
nationality Nationality. May be used instead of citizenship (below) or vice versa in cases where any confusion could result. Should only be used with citizenship when they somehow differ. Should only be used if nationality cannot be inferred from the birthplace. Do not use a flag template.
education Education, e.g. degree, institution and graduation year, if relevant. If very little information is available or relevant, the alma_mater parameter may be more appropriate.
alma_mater Wikipedia:Alma mater. This parameter is a more concise alternative to education, and will most often simply consist of the linked name of the last-attended higher education institution. It is usually not relevant to included either parameter for non-graduates, but article talk page consensus may conclude otherwise, as at Wikipedia:Bill Gates.
occupation Occupation(s) as given in the lead.
employer Employer(s), if relevant.
organization Non-employing organization(s), if relevant.
notable_works Title(s) of notable work(s) (publications, compositions, sculptures, films, etc.) by the subject, if any.

See also "awards" parameter, below, for awarded honors that are not really titles. A single award should not use both parameters.

awards Notable awards. If many, link to an appropriate section of the article instead. See also "title" parameter, above, for awarded titles. A single award should not use both parameters.

Used for embedding other infoboxes into this one.
website Official website only. Unofficial websites should be placed under ==External links== in the body of the article. Use {{URL}} as in {{URL|Example.com}}. Do not include the www. part unless the server is misconfigured and requires it. Use Wikipedia:camel case capitalization to make multiword domain names easier to read.
footnotes Notes about any of the infobox data.
box_width The infobox width, such as: box_width=220px (default: 22em). A space character between the number and the unit of measurement breaks the parameter. This parameter should not normally need to be set.
